Hi there. Been working on my Phase 1 205GTI 1.6 1986 for last two summers. At the beginning car was in really bad condition - body was damaged by rust all over from the back to the front, engine not running, all of the suspension parts needed to be replaced and the previous owner messed up with wiring a lot... This year plan was to do the the body works of engine bay and the floor, and make everything what's needed to pass the inspection - last time this car passed it was on 2010 :D Managed to do all what was planned!
